Athens is a passing team. Sano 1,375 yards passing, 18 touchdowns 0 INT. 429 Yards rushing with 6 touchdowns. Those stats are from 6 games.
Running backs Tyler Roback (402 yards, 3 TDs) and Mikel Castell (432 yards, 6 TDs)
Athens biggest strength is the deep ball threat. Robert Dickleman and Trace Albin are averaging 23 yards per catch
This could turn into a track meet
